Il racconto musicale di «Etnomusic» numero 14, la rassegna dedicata alle musiche dal mondo dall’Ente manifestazioni pescaresi, tocca quest’anno cinque punti del globo con il blues di marca Usa di Eric Bibb, le cornamuse d’Irlanda con Diarmaid Moynihan band, la pizzica salentina di Officina Zoè, la musica d’autore contemporanea di confine tra Brasile e Argentina, di Renato Borghetti, e le canzoni surrealiste the British Robin Hitchcock. Five appointments by Monday, February 28 to Monday, April 18, in the usual setting of the auditorium Flaiano of Pescara. Tickets to ten euro and the knowledge that "perhaps this is the year
worst in the history of the show in Italy," as he bitterly said President Lucio Fumo Empa first to explain the bill, yesterday morning in the auditorium flanked Flaiano by the Culture of the Municipality of Pescara, Elena Seller. Smoke could not fail to remember the funding cuts "of 75 percent in two years' at the musical event by the region of Abruzzo. "This year we will have a 35 per cent of the budget less than last year and the additional problem of cutting 40 percent of the FUS (single Fund of the show) made by Minister Tremonti. The only one left with the same contribution to our show is the city of Pescara. Under these conditions really do not know until this year we will continue. For now I just say that the Pescara Jazz Festival will have only three days instead of four, less than a miracle. " The only consolation that he had put together "happily" Etnomusic the five dates, "with the ability to transcend musical genres and geographic boundaries, and due to cost." On Monday 28 with Eric Bibb (guitar, vocals), accompanied by Grant Dermody (armonica a bocca) per un concerto radicato nella tradizione blues e sfumature folk che hanno portato a defire la musica del duo «nuovo blues mondiale». Giovedì 17 marzo è di scena Diarmaid, riconosciuto come uno dei principali solisti di uillean pipes, le tipiche cornamuse irlandesi. Con lui (alle cornamuse e whistles) sul palco Donncha Moynihan (chitarre), Brian Kissane (accordion), Nic France (percussioni). Mercoledì 23 marzo arrivano i ritmi travolgenti e popolari del Salento con Officina Zoè, di ritorno nella rassegna pescarese a quattro anni di distanza. Giovedì 31 marzo, invece, una novità con la musica di Renato Borghetti, fisarmonicista brasiliano interprete contemporaneo di gaita ponto (fisarmonica diatonic) for the few Italian shows accompanied by Pedro Figueiredo (sax, flute), Daniel SA (semi-acoustic guitar) and Victor Peixoto (piano). Closes Monday, April 18 Robyn Hitchcock, folk singer and artist paid also in the arts and literature, whose name is a prelude to a concert (accompanied by his guitar cellist Jenny Adejayan) and promising nothing short of bizarre.
